Mesothelioma

Mesothelioma is an uncommon form of cancer that is found in the mesothelium, the thin membrane that covers many of our internal organs. The disease is typically caused by exposure to asbestos which was once used in construction, shipbuilding, manufacturing and other industries. Asbestos sufferers should be aware of the risks and consult a reputable mesothelioma lawyer as soon as they can to safeguard their rights.

It can take up to 50 years for the symptoms of mesothelioma to manifest. They can be a sign of other conditions. This makes it difficult to identify mesothelioma and then treat it. If you or a loved one has been diagnosed with mesothelioma you could be eligible for compensation from the companies that exposed you to asbestos.

A doctor can identify mesothelioma by a physical exam and an exposure history to asbestos. They will also perform a series tests, including scans of the imaging to study the internal organs of your body and check for signs of malignant tissues.

After these tests, the doctor may request a biopsy of the affected area. This involves removing the tissue in a small amount and examining it under microscope to determine the type of mesothelioma present. Malignant mesothelioma is classified as epithelioid (epidermoid) or Sarcomatoid (sarcomatoid) or mixed.

After the test results are out the doctor can start making a treatment plan for you. This could include surgery, chemotherapy or radiation. Certain patients are able to survive for months or years after a mesothelioma diagnosis, so it's important to follow your doctor's advice regarding treatment.

Statute of Limitations

A statute of limitations, also also known as a prescriptive period is an act of the legislative body to define the maximum period of time within which to pursue legal action against a person for committing an offense or other civil wrong. This limitation is set to serve a variety of reasons, such as to preserve important evidence, to make it easier for witnesses to recall specific events, and for justice to be served within a reasonable time frame. The statute of limitations is different for every state, and differ based on the kind of claim, ranging from personal injury lawsuits to wrongful death claims.

The time limit for asbestos cases is among the most complex and complicated laws that pertain to this particular toxic tort, since there are a number of different deadlines to be met. To avoid missing deadlines, mesothelioma sufferers and their families should seek advice from an experienced attorney.

There are a myriad of factors that can affect a statute of limitation however, for mesothelioma-related cases the clock begins when a person receives a diagnoses or when the death of a loved one is due to an asbestos-related disease.
